Abstract

The aim of this research is threefold. At first, it tries to distinguish a set of comprehensive policy measures which tackle both radicalism and terrorism with regards to the European foreign fighter problem. Different radicalization models are discussed, each theorizing a path towards radicalization. Theories regarding the radicalization process will be used to develop theory-based policy measures. The second aim of this thesis is putting four distinctive European strategies, being the Dutch, English, German and Belgian, to the test. It is looked upon whether or not they incorporate the comprehensive set of policy measures. The entire study is related to the European call for more cooperation in the fields of counter-radicalism and counter-terrorism. At last it is aimed to question enactors of the strategy ‘on the ground’ whether they believe the carried out strategy works in order to provide a practicality test.
